However, to have a serious discussion, the significance of the GOAT Network's tour may not just be about community hype. The ZK Rollup + BitVM2 technology they are promoting attempts to create DeFi on Bitcoin, which is itself a bold endeavor. I have previously mentioned the technical details of GOAT, such as decentralized sequencers and trust-minimized bridging, the transfer of BTC from the mainnet to Layer 2 starting from 0.0001 BTC, which has a low threshold that is somewhat enticing. This technical route is solid and well-founded, targeting the pain points of the BTC ecosystem—slow transactions, high fees, and poor scalability. If they can elevate the narrative of BTCFi and attract more developers to build applications on the GOAT Network, it could indeed spark a wave of enthusiasm.
But to say that the cryptocurrency market can replicate the great bull market of 2017, I think it's a bit difficult! The bull market of 2017 was the result of the cryptocurrency myth's barbaric growth, with retail investors FOMO, speculative drive, and a regulatory vacuum. The current market environment has changed; there are more institutional players, compliance requirements are higher, and the enthusiasm of retail investors is not so easily ignited.
